So I built this decent little studio (16X12) in the one of the rooms in our new house and now I am stuck trying to decide what the hell flash combo to go with.
I must of gone thru about 30 web pages today looking at different combos..
$$ arent unlimited and it would be nice to kill 2 birds with one stone and use the same setup for some portable work if needed. Obviously if paid work increased I could upgrade.

Current setup is a D3 with SB800. Could I get by with using the new SB900 as the main light in the studio with the SB800 ? Can the SB900 be used with a softbox or do I shoot thru an umbrella instead ?

It would be nice to get this setup working as I could then take it with me if needed.

As far as wireless triggers, would I need a pocket wizard to fire the SB900 as the D3 has no onboard flash ??

I would say that my budget is prob $2k.

Any advice would be appreciated.

I have Profoto Monoblocks and the images and color are great with them. They come with a case and umbrellas. The two light kits are on special now and a good value. I have three lights and want a couple more.

The quality is excellent and the system will last you. Buy the best you can afford so you can just add to it as you grow. If you get cheap you will end up replacing things instead of adding to the system.
